Denier Bracteate - John I

Denier Bracteate - John I - obverse

Obverse © Numismatik Lanz Auctions

Features

Issuer Abbey of Hersfeld (German States)
Abbot John I (Johann I) (1200-1214)
Type Standard circulation coins
Years 1200-1214
Value 1 Denier
Currency Denier
Composition Silver
Weight 0.80 g
Shape Round (irregular)
Technique Hammered (bracteate)
Demonetized Yes
Number
N#
145038
References Bonh# 1303
Friedrich Bonhoff. Sammlung Dr. med Friedrich Bonhoff, Hamburg. Dr. Busso Peus Nachfolger, Frankfurt am Main, Hesse, Germany (2 volumes).

Obverse

Seated facing abbotover arch holding crozier, eagle and tower to the sides.

Reverse

Blank.

Mint

Arnstadt, Germany
